Recognizing and Responding to Hazmat Incidents
When confronting a potential dangerous materials situation, swift identification is paramount. Look for clear warning indicators such as unfamiliar objects, emitting fumes or presenting unusual colors.
Rapidly remove the area and contact the appropriate personnel, providing a detailed description of the occurrence. Adhere to established emergency guidelines and stay instructions from trained officials.
Bear in mind that your safety is paramount. Do not undertake to move any unknown materials yourself, as this could intensify the incident.
